• Charge this device only with the included or authorized cable and power

adapter. Using other adapters may cause fire, electric shock, and damage

the device and the adapter.

• After charging is complete, disconnect the adapter from both the device

and the power outlet. Do not charge the device for more than 12 hours.

• The battery must be recycled or disposed of separately from household

waste. Mishandling the battery may cause fire or explosion. Dispose of

or recycle the device, its battery, and accessories according to your local

regulations.

• Do not disassemble, hit, crush, or burn the battery. If the battery appears

deformed or damaged, stop using it immediately.

• User shall not remove or alter the battery. Removal or repair of the battery

shall only be done by an authorized repair center of the manufacturer.

• Keep your device dry.

• Do not try to repair the device yourself. If any part of the device does not

work properly, contact Mi customer support or bring your device to an

authorized repair center.

• Connect other devices according to their instruction manuals. Do not

connect incompatible devices to this device.

• For AC/DC adapters, the socket-outlet shall be installed near the

equipment and shall be easily accessible.

Safety Precautions

• Observe all applicable laws and rules restricting use of tablet in specific

situations and environments.

• Do not use your tablet at petrol stations or in any explosive atmosphere or

potentially explosive environment, including fueling areas, below decks on

boats, fuel or chemical transfer or storage facilities, or areas where the air

may contain chemicals or particles such as grain, dust, or metal powders.

Obey all posted signs to turn off wireless devices such as your tablet or

other radio equipment. Turn off your tablet or wireless device when in a

blasting area or in areas requiring “two-way radios” or “electronic devices”

to be turned off to prevent potential hazards.

• Do not use your tablet in hospital operating rooms, emergency rooms,

or intensive care units. Always comply with all rules and regulations

of hospitals and health centers. If you have a medical device, please

consult your doctor and the device manufacturer to determine whether

your tablet may interfere with the device’s operation. To avoid potential

interference with a pacemaker, always maintain a minimum distance of

15 cm between your tablet and the pacemaker. To avoid interference with

medical equipment, do not use your tablet near hearing aids, cochlear

implants, or other similar devices.
